A pregnant 17-year-old was found dead days after her family says she disappeared and now they're demanding answers and are questioning the response of the City of Barnwell Police Department (CBPD).

Maylashia Hogg's body was found on Sunday, February 18 near Perry Street and Main Street less than a mile from her home.

WACH FOX News' Kei'Yona Jordon reached out to the CBPD on Monday, February 19 to request a missing persons report.

An official with CBPD said WACH FOX News would not be able to obtain a report due to the observance of President's Day.

Hogg was nine months pregnant and was expecting a baby girl, Londyn Charity, on Valentine's Day.

Family members say Hogg was reported missing on Thursday, February 8 and was scheduled to be induced on Tuesday, February 13.

A missing persons flyer was shared on the City of Barnwell Police Department Facebook page from the Barnwell Sheriff's Office on Wednesday, February 14.

According to Kimberly Kite, a former law enforcement officer and founder of The Broken Link Foundation, said Hogg's family reached out to her after they received no help from law enforcement to alert the public of her disappearance.

On Tuesday, February 13, a post to CBPD's Facebook page requested the public's help locating Michael Gene Still.

Still was last seen on Tuesday, February 6 at Colony West Apartments.

In an updated post on February 20, officials responded to questions about speculation that Hogg's and Still's case are related.

The Barnwell County Sheriff’s Office has been actively investigating the disappearance of Michael Still who was last seen on February 6, 2024 at his apartment in Colony West. BCSO has used multiple resources from other agencies in our search for Still. Though there is no concrete evidence that Still’s disappearance is related to Malayshia Hogg, we continue to work closely with Barnwell Police Dept. to share information and follow all leads.
